Figure 7-17. Add/Delete IGMP Entry window
To Add/Modify to the table or Delete from the table, check the desired option button, enter a value from 1 to 4094
in the VLAN ID field, enter a value between 30 and 9999 in the Age-out Timer field, enable or disable the IGMP
Status control, and then click Apply.
The information above is described as follows:
Add/Modify to the table Allows you to create or edit an entry for the table.
Delete from the table Allows you to delete an IGMP entry from the table.
VLAN ID This is the VLAN that will be defined on this screen. Note a VLAN ID is from 1 to 4094.
Age-out Timer Specifies the time in seconds the switch will wait before trying to host IGMP on the VLAN.
IGMP Status Enables/disables IGMP on this VLAN. Up to 12 VLANs can be enabled to handle IGMP
packets at any one time.
